怎么用自己的笔记本搭建一个可以点击访问的远程主机
时间: 2024-04-20 09:24:17 浏览: 10
您可以通过以下步骤在自己的笔记本上搭建一个可以点击访问的远程主机:
1. 确保您的笔记本上安装了适当的操作系统,如Linux或Windows。
2. 配置您的网络设置,确保您的笔记本可以通过公共IP地址或域名访问。
3. 安装远程访问软件,如OpenSSH(对于Linux)或Remote Desktop Protocol(对于Windows)。
4. 配置远程访问软件以允许远程连接。这通常涉及到设置用户名和密码,以及指定允许访问的IP地址范围。
5. 确保您的防火墙设置允许远程访问软件通过特定的端口进行通信。默认情况下,SSH使用端口22,而RDP使用端口3389。
6. 启动远程访问软件,并使用远程主机的IP地址或域名以及您配置的用户名和密码进行连接。
请注意,这只是一个基本的指南,实际步骤可能因操作系统和远程访问软件的不同而有所差异。如果您需要更详细的指导,请参考相关操作系统和软件的文档或在线资源。
相关问题
如何在自己的笔记本上搭建一个属于自己的ChatGPT,详细说一下
要搭建一个属于自己的ChatGPT,需要进行以下步骤:
1. 准备数据集:首先需要有一个聊天数据集,可以在网上搜索或者自己手动收集。数据集应该尽可能多样化,包括不同主题、语言、口音等。数据集可以是文本格式,也可以是语音格式。
2. 安装Python:ChatGPT是基于Python语言开发的,因此需要先安装Python。可以从官网下载安装包,或者使用Anaconda等Python环境管理工具。
3. 安装依赖:ChatGPT需要一些Python库的支持,如TensorFlow、Keras、NLTK等。可以使用pip命令安装这些库,例如:pip install tensorflow,pip install keras,pip install nltk。
4. 训练模型:使用准备好的数据集进行模型训练。可以选择使用预训练的GPT模型进行fine-tuning,也可以从头开始训练一个新的模型。训练时需要设置一些超参数,如batch size、learning rate、epoch等。
5. 部署模型:训练完成后,需要将模型部署到自己的笔记本上。可以使用Flask等框架开发一个简单的Web应用,接收用户输入的文本或语音,调用模型进行预测,然后返回结果给用户。
6. 测试和优化:部署完成后,需要进行测试和优化。可以使用一些测试工具进行压力测试,检查模型的性能和稳定性,并根据测试结果优化模型和应用程序。
总之,搭建一个属于自己的ChatGPT需要进行一些技术上的操作,需要一定的编程能力和经验。如果没有相关经验,可以参考一些开源的ChatGPT项目,或者使用一些已经开发好的聊天机器人平台。
如何在自己的笔记本上搭建一个属于自己的ChatGPT,用python编写,详细说一下
搭建一个属于自己的ChatGPT需要以下步骤:
1. 安装Python 3.7以上版本
可以到官网下载并安装Python 3.7以上版本,安装完成后可以在命令行输入python查看是否安装成功。
2. 安装必要的Python包
需要安装以下Python包:
- transformers
- torch
- flask
- flask-cors
可以使用pip install命令安装以上包,如:
```
pip install transformers
pip install torch
pip install flask
pip install flask-cors
```
3. 下载预训练的GPT模型
可以从Hugging Face的模型仓库中下载预训练的GPT模型,如:
```
from transformers import GPT2Tokenizer, GPT2LMHeadModel
tokenizer = GPT2Tokenizer.from_pretrained("gpt2")
model = GPT2LMHeadModel.from_pretrained("gpt2")
```
4. 编写Flask应用程序
可以编写一个Flask应用程序,使用上述步骤中下载的GPT模型,接收用户的输入并返回GPT模型生成的下一句话。
```
from flask import Flask, request, jsonify
from flask_cors import CORS
from transformers import GPT2Tokenizer, GPT2LMHeadModel
app = Flask(__name__)
CORS(app)
tokenizer = GPT2Tokenizer.from_pretrained("gpt2")
model = GPT2LMHeadModel.from_pretrained("gpt2")
model.eval()
@app.route('/generate', methods=['POST'])
def generate():
input_text = request.json['input_text']
input_ids = tokenizer.encode(input_text, return_tensors='pt')
output_ids = model.generate(input_ids, max_length=100, do_sample=True)
output_text = tokenizer.decode(output_ids[0], skip_special_tokens=True)
return jsonify({'output_text': output_text})
if __name__ == '__main__':
app.run()
```
5. 运行Flask应用程序
可以在命令行中运行Flask应用程序,如:
```
export FLASK_APP=app.py
flask run
```
然后就可以在浏览器中访问http://localhost:5000/generate,使用自己的ChatGPT了。